As 2008 is coming to a close it is time for an
update of what the young members have been doing throughout the
year.
We started with the AGM held at Perth in February,
when a new Vice Chairman was appointed in Varrie Dyet and Emma
Railton was appointed as Secretary. I would firstly like to thank
Varrie and Emma for their support throughout the year.
It has
been a busy year for the young members as we hosted the second
Youth forum as part of the 17th Simmental World Congress. It
was an honour and privilege to be Chairman of the young members
association during this event. Many life long friends where made
from both home and abroad.

Across the Country Regional Clubs
held their annual Stock Judging competitions whilst preparing
for the Royal Show and for the World Congress competition held
at Sacombe by kind permission of the Borlase family.

This year’s Royal
Show was badly effected by the Blue Tongue restrictions however,
despite the limited number of cattle it was extremely encouraging
to see so many young members forward to take part. The competition
was again run in conjunction with the British Blue and British
Blonde Cattle Societies. Congratulations to all the prize winners
and thank you to everyone for taking part. I would like to thank
our sponsors for their continued support and without whose donations
this competition could not take place.
